St. Peter's Cemetery (Petersfriedhof)

Highlight • Historical Site

Mozart's sister Maria Anna is here, as is Clemens Holzmeister, the architect of the Great Festival Hall. The dead have been buried here for more than 1,300 years. The view of the Hohensalzburg Fortress is just as unique.

August 14, 2019

Salzburg is not called the "Rome of the North" for nothing. For centuries, the city was an important center of power for the Catholic Church. The large number of churches and magnificent buildings still bear witness to this era today. Reason enough to take a closer look at some of the places of worship
